Millville to rename City Park Drive to Martin Luther King Jr. Drive

The Millville City Commission is holding its regular session meeting on December 19, 2023. The agenda includes a public hearing on an ordinance to rename City Park Drive to Martin Luther King Jr. Drive, as well as a second reading of an ordinance to repeal and replace the city's personnel policies chapter. The commission will also consider several resolutions, including a letter of support for a cannabis business, a shared services agreement for a Code Blue warming center, and a contract for equipment rental.

✓ Decided: Millville Commission approves $500,000 for capital improvements

The City Commission approved an ordinance for capital improvements and acquisitions totaling $500,000. The board also vacated public rights to a portion of Mickle Street and entered into an easement agreement with Atlantic City Electric.

✓ Decided: City Commission halts Four Seasons development Phase 3 over safety issues

The Commission reviewed severe infrastructure failures at the Four Seasons development, including hazardous roads and non-compliant lighting. Officials stated that Phase 3 will not be approved until the developer corrects existing safety and zoning issues. The board also approved the payment of bills and the June 20, 2023 meeting minutes.

✓ Decided: Millville City Commission expands Airport Enterprise zone by 1,000 acres

The Commission approved a resolution to expand the New AE zone to include 1,000 acres near the Hurley Industrial Park and Airport. The board also passed an ordinance amending Chapter 30 Land Use and Development Regulations to implement the 2017 Land Use Element of the Master Plan. Additionally, the board authorized the payment of bills and approved the June 20, 2023, work session minutes.

✓ Decided: City approves purchase of 10 Buck Street for $1 for waterfront redevelopment

The commission approved the purchase of the former Paula Ring Building at 10 Buck Street from Cumberland County for $1, with proceeds split if resold. Three ordinances were adopted on second reading, including one adjusting compensation for an assistant maintenance supervisor. The consent agenda added $382,278 in grant revenues to the 2023 budget. A shared services agreement for mosquito control training was also approved.

✓ Decided: Millville City Commission approves budget cap increase and reviews 2023 budget

The Commission adopted an ordinance to exceed municipal budget appropriation limits and establish a Cap Bank for 2023. Officials presented the 2023 budget, which includes a 0.05 cent tax rate increase and utilizes $4,758,400 in surplus. The board also held a public hearing regarding budget allocations and library funding.

Commission to vote on $1.44M water/sewer fee installment plan for Oatly

The Millville City Commission is holding its regular session meeting with a mix of routine approvals and notable financial actions. Key items include a resolution to let Oatly pay $1,439,380 in water and sewer connection fees over 119 monthly installments, a contract with the Cumberland County SPCA for animal sheltering, and several ordinance first readings for charity coin drops. The agenda also includes standard approvals of minutes, police reports, and tax records.

Millville to buy former bank property, approve $430K redevelopment deal

The Millville City Commission will vote on several resolutions, including purchasing the former Millville National Bank property for $400,000 and approving a redevelopment agreement for the same site with Millville Works I, LLC for $430,000. The agenda also includes public hearings on three ordinances, a $48,600 state grant for police, and various professional service contracts. Several items are routine, such as bill approvals and mortgage discharges.

Millville Commission to vote on cannabis transfer tax and multiple contracts

The Millville City Commission will hold public hearings on two second-reading ordinances: one accepting a donated property at 418 Smith Street, and another imposing a transfer tax on cannabis sales and a user tax on multi-license holders. The board will also consider first-reading ordinances to repeal a professional services code section, allow the same attorney for planning and zoning boards, and amend sewer/water connection fees. Additionally, the agenda includes numerous resolutions for professional services contracts, liquor licenses for Fairfield Inn & Suites, and a letter of support for a cannabis facility.
